Les mod\u00e8les de pr\u00e9diction bas\u00e9s sur l&#039;IA, tels que le programme d&#039;IBM pour l&#039;initiative SunShot du minist\u00e8re am\u00e9ricain de l&#039;\u00c9nergie, sont un mod\u00e8le d&#039;auto-apprentissage qui am\u00e9liore sa pr\u00e9cision avec le temps, car il a acc\u00e8s \u00e0 des ensembles de donn\u00e9es plus vastes.<\/p>\n<h2 class=\"wp-block-heading\">Pr\u00e9vision de g\u00e9n\u00e9ration<\/h2>\n<p>Le soleil, le vent et l\u2019eau sont les trois principales sources d\u2019\u00e9nergie renouvelables permettant d\u2019abandonner les combustibles fossiles. Ceux-ci sont disponibles en abondance et relativement simples \u00e0 exploiter. Cependant, chacun d\u2019entre eux comporte un \u00e9l\u00e9ment d\u2019impr\u00e9visibilit\u00e9. Ceux-ci d\u00e9pendent des conditions m\u00e9t\u00e9orologiques, qui \u00e9chappent \u00e0 notre contr\u00f4le. L&#039;adoption de l&#039;intelligence artificielle dans la gestion de l&#039;\u00e9nergie peut aider \u00e0 lire les donn\u00e9es historiques et les param\u00e8tres m\u00e9t\u00e9orologiques actuels pour pr\u00e9voir la g\u00e9n\u00e9ration future. Pendant les p\u00e9riodes de haute disponibilit\u00e9, les op\u00e9rateurs peuvent approvisionner l\u2019ensemble de la client\u00e8le gr\u00e2ce aux \u00e9nergies renouvelables. Lorsque la disponibilit\u00e9 est insuffisante pour r\u00e9pondre \u00e0 la demande pr\u00e9vue, ils peuvent d\u00e9placer une partie de la charge vers la production d\u2019\u00e9nergie fossile pour maintenir un approvisionnement stable.<\/p>\n<h2 class=\"wp-block-heading\">Pr\u00e9vision de la demande<\/h2>\n<p>Les soci\u00e9t\u00e9s de distribution d&#039;\u00e9lectricit\u00e9 utilisent les tendances historiques de la demande pour pr\u00e9dire la demande attendue. Bien qu\u2019utile, ce mod\u00e8le est sujet \u00e0 des erreurs car il ne prend pas en compte les donn\u00e9es actuelles (m\u00e9t\u00e9o, imagerie satellite, vitesse du vent, intensit\u00e9 solaire, capteurs, etc.). Compte tenu de l\u2019impr\u00e9visibilit\u00e9 des conditions m\u00e9t\u00e9orologiques, de la disponibilit\u00e9 de la lumi\u00e8re solaire et de la vitesse du vent, il est crucial de m\u00e9langer les donn\u00e9es pass\u00e9es avec les param\u00e8tres actuels avant de pr\u00e9dire la demande attendue. L\u2019IA peut traiter de grandes quantit\u00e9s de donn\u00e9es complexes et d\u00e9velopper des algorithmes plus pr\u00e9cis pour pr\u00e9voir avec pr\u00e9cision les tendances de la demande pour les prochaines heures.<\/p>\n<h2 class=\"wp-block-heading\">Gestion du r\u00e9seau<\/h2>\n<p>Les r\u00e9seaux \u00e9lectriques constituent l\u2019\u00e9pine dorsale de l\u2019infrastructure \u00e9nerg\u00e9tique. Les algorithmes d&#039;intelligence artificielle peuvent exploiter de grands ensembles de donn\u00e9es pour conna\u00eetre les mod\u00e8les de charge et garantir une utilisation optimale. Les r\u00e9seaux peuvent s&#039;adapter aux pr\u00e9visions de production et de demande de charge pour offrir une fiabilit\u00e9 accrue tout en maintenant les co\u00fbts \u00e0 un niveau bas. Alors que les gouvernements encouragent l\u2019adoption de l\u2019\u00e9nergie solaire aupr\u00e8s des consommateurs domestiques et commerciaux, les r\u00e9seaux deviennent bidirectionnels. L\u2019IA peut permettre \u00e0 diff\u00e9rents composants du syst\u00e8me \u00e9lectrique de communiquer entre eux et d\u2019\u00e9viter les congestions.<\/p>\n<h2 class=\"wp-block-heading\">Entretien des infrastructures<\/h2>\n<p>Les r\u00e9seaux \u00e9lectriques sont un maillage complexe de composants \u00e9lectriques et les dysfonctionnements ne sont qu\u2019une question de temps. Les pannes soudaines prennent du temps et les perturbations qui en r\u00e9sultent entra\u00eenent des pertes pour l\u2019\u00e9conomie. Les syst\u00e8mes bas\u00e9s sur l&#039;IA peuvent fournir des donn\u00e9es en temps r\u00e9el sur la sant\u00e9 globale du r\u00e9seau et pr\u00e9dire quelles parties du r\u00e9seau sont les plus susceptibles de se d\u00e9clencher. Les op\u00e9rateurs peuvent utiliser ces donn\u00e9es pour effectuer une maintenance pr\u00e9ventive pendant les p\u00e9riodes de faible demande. Les clients peuvent \u00eatre alert\u00e9s \u00e0 l\u2019avance pour garantir une perturbation minimale.<\/p>\n<h2 class=\"wp-block-heading\">Excellence op\u00e9rationnelle pilot\u00e9e par l\u2019automatisation<\/h2>\n<p>Une pr\u00e9vision pr\u00e9cise de la demande, une production d\u2019\u00e9lectricit\u00e9 flexible, un transport d\u2019\u00e9nergie efficace via un r\u00e9seau sain et une distribution sont quelques-uns des \u00e9l\u00e9ments mobiles cl\u00e9s d\u2019un syst\u00e8me \u00e9lectrique.
